The Air We Breathe



This looks like there is smoke from a fire down the street, right? No. It is the air that we are currently breathing in the Sacramento area. As far as I know there are no fires in the immediate vacinity. My guess is that the smoke is coming from the over 47,000 acres that have been burning since June 21st in Butte County just north of us.



The current temperature. Yes, that says 109 degrees. The air that we have been breathing for the past several weeks combined with the sweltering temps we have been experiencing this week is making conditions intolerable. If the conditions are bad here, I cannot imagine what they must be like for the people who live in the midst of where the fires are raging and for the brave men and women who are desperately trying to put these fires out.
